Michelin-starred restaurants in Japan often have fewer seats than their counterparts abroad. This is especially true for sushi and kaiseki (traditional Japanese multi-course meal) establishments, where it's common to find just eight counter seats. As a result, booking all eight seats on a given date can be challenging. In Japan, many Michelin-starred fine dining establishments—such as sushi and kaiseki (traditional multi-course) restaurants—primarily feature counter seating. However, there are also exceptional spots where you can enjoy a more intimate and leisurely dining experience in a private room. Located in the heart of historical Kyoto, Restaurant Hiramatsu Kodaiji has proudly held one Michelin star for three consecutive years. In addition to its top-quality cuisine, its warm hospitality and the stunning views from the restaurant where guests can overlook Kyoto's cherry blossoms in spring and vivid autumn foliage captivate many diners.
